He amount of education the typical person receives varies substantially among countries. Suppose you were to compare one country, called Gilder, with a highly educated labor force with another country, called Florin, with a less educated labor force. Assume that education only affects the level of the efficiency of labor. Also assume that the countries are otherwise the same: they have the same population growth, the same saving rate, the same depreciation rate, and the same rate of technological progress. Both countries are described by the Solow model and are in their steady states. Answer the following questions about Gilder and Florin. a. Which country will have a higher growth of total income?
